hi guys i have a core i7 920 d0 stepping, and corsair h50 my idles are 38-39 degrees celsius. is that right? or should it be lower? if i get push pull will it get lower?
 
no its actually underclocked due to speed step at 2.4
 
and do i just go by core#0 temp or do i take the average of all cores?
 
Idle temps really dont mean much. What are the LOAD temps, like under Prim95 Torture test, Large FFT? Just keep it under 80C load and all will be well.

Yes, a push/pull combo would help. Check out the Front page article on this cooler. ;)
